This manual uses SI unit system (International System of Units) for pressure, force (load), torque and
stress. This manual newly adopts the international unit construction system (SI unit system) followed by the
conventional imperial and metric systems enclosed by ( ) and [ ] as described below.
<Reference>
What is the SI unit system?
Although the measurement unit is standardized mostly with metric system in the world, the metric system
includes different kinds of unit systems.
Though the metric system was established expecting that a single unit system would be used in the world,
various physical units were established later, resulting in branching the metric system in different unit
systems.
The new unit system is called "International System of Units" because it was established for the purpose of
unifying the different unit systems.
Since the metric system was initially established in France, and International Bureau of Weights and
Measures (IBWM) is located in Paris, General Conference of Weights and Measures (GCWM) passed a
resolution of the international unit system as "Systéme International d'Unités (French)" that is abbreviated as
"SI unit".
For example, conventional metric system uses the unit of mass (kg) and unit of force (kg or kgf) without
discriminating them, but the SI unit system uses, for example, "kg" as the unit of mass, and "N" as the unit of
force, aiming to apply a kind of unit for a kind of physical quantity.

£°Ê
`iÌvV>ÌÊ}iÊ-iÀ>Ê ÕLiÀ®
Engine serial number is stamped on the Swivel bracket of
outboard motor body.
Ó°Ê-iVÕÀ}ÊvÊÜÀÊÃ>viÌÞ
£®ÊÀiÊ*ÀiÛiÌ
Gasoline is hazardous material and very flammable. Do not
handle gasoline near ignition source such as spark or static
electricity.
Ó®Ê6iÌ>Ì
Exhaust gas or gasoline vapor is hazardous for human
health. Be sure to ventilate well when working indoors.
ήÊ*ÀÌiVÌ
Wear a pair of goggles, working gloves and safety shoes to
protect human body from chemicals and oils and eyes from
particles generated by grinding or polishing works. Avoid
adhesion of matters such as oil, grease or sealing agent to
the skin. In case of exposure to such matters, wash away
with soap or warm water immediately.
{®ÊiÕiÊ*>ÀÌÃ
Use parts and/or chemicals that are genuine items or
recommended.

x®Ê/Ã
Use specified special tools to prevent damaging to parts
and to perform work safely and surely. Be sure to follow
installation procedures described in this manual and use
tightening torque specified.
È®Ê,iVi`>ÌÃÊÊÃiÀÛVi
Remove foreign substances and dirt from outboard motor
body and individual parts by cleaning. Apply recommended
oil or grease to rotating areas and sliding surfaces. After
individual works, always perform verifications such as
ensuring smooth movement and sealing.

Ç®Ê>ÕÌÃÊÊ`Ã>ÃÃiL}Ê>`Ê
Ê >ÃÃiL}ÊV«iÌÃ
(1) Secure outboard motor to dedicated stand firmly.
(2) Take special care not to scratch painted surface or mating
surfaces of cylinder and crankcase.
(3) Replace unreusable parts such as packings, gaskets, O
rings, oil seals, spring pins or split pins with new ones after
they were removed . Replace deformed snap rings with new
ones.
(4) When replacing parts, be sure to use genuine parts. For
fluids such as gear oil, use genuine product.
(5) Be sure to use special tools that are specified, and perform
the works properly.
(6) When reassembling parts, use their mating marks. For parts
without mating marks, simple marking makes reassembling
easier. Use applicable parts list for reference.
(7) Clean individual parts that have been removed, and check
their conditions.
(8) When reassembling parts, take sufficient care also for
details such as fits, repair limits, air tight, clogging of oil
holes for lubrication and greasing, packings, wirings and
piping. For components using many bolts and nuts for
assembling, such as cylinder head and crankcase, tighten
all the fasteners evenly to their specified torques clockwise
in two or three stages, inner ones first and then outer ones.
(Reverse the order when disassembling.)
(9) When installing bearings, face the flat (numbered) side to
the special assembling tool.
(10) When installing oil seals, be careful not to scratch the
surface of the lip that contacts with the shaft, and install
them in correct orientation. Apply recommended grease to
the lip before installation.
(11) When applying liquid packing, take sufficient care for the
thickness and quantity. Excessive application may be oozed
out, adversely affecting interior of the crankcase. Use
adhesive after thoroughly reading the instructions.

Ó®Êi>ÃÕÀ}ÊÃÌÀÕiÌÃ
For the following measuring instruments, use commercially available ones.
Circuit tester (HIOKI 3000 Serise : Resistance : 1Ω, 10Ω, 10 kΩ, AC voltage : 30 to 300V, DC voltage : 30V )
Vernier calipers ( M1 type, 300 mm )
Micrometer ( minimum graduation of 0.01, outer, 0 to 25 mm, 25 to 50 mm, 50 to 75 mm )
Cylinder gauge ( 4 to 6 mm, 10 to 25 mm, 25 to 30 mm, 50 to 75 mm )
Ring gauge ( ø5.5, ø17, ø42, ø70 )
Dial gauge ( minimum graduation of 0.01 )
Thickness gauge ( 0.03 to 0.3 mm )
V block
Surface plate ( 500 mm x 500 mm )
Dial gauge magnet base or dial gauge stand

£®Ê/iÃÌÊ*À«iiÀ
P/N. 3RS-64110-0
Outer diameter : 130 mm
With : 20 mm
Outboard motor model Rotational speed at WOT
(Wide Open Throttle) (r/min)
MFS9.9E Approx.4000
MFS15E Approx.5000
MFS20E Approx.5800
